Trinamul Leader Shot At, Critical in South 24-Parganas

The critically injured local Trinamul Congress leader has been identified as Krishnapada Mondal.

He was shot at from close range while he was travelling on his motorcycle in the Nodakhali area.

According to eyewitnesses, three unknown assailants, all of whom were probably outsiders, shot at Mondal from a close range and escaped.

He was rushed to a hospital in Kolkata where he is currently undergoing treatment.
